Prosecutors will review the case, including the mayor's reaction, after receiving the police reports, likely on Friday, district attorney spokeswoman Shelly Orio said.
"Whether you're hit in the face with a pie or a fist, you've been assaulted and you're generally allowed to respond with similar force," said Rory Little, a former litigator and professor at University of California Hastings College of the Law.
Johnson's response "probably is not a disproportionate reaction, though it might not be the reaction we want our public officials to have," Little said
